Q. If a body of mass $m$ is moving on a rough horizontal surface of coefficient of kinetic friction $\mu $ , the net electromagnetic force exerted by the surface on the body is

Solution:

As, normal force and friction force are the two electromagnetic forces acting on the body
The net electromagnetic force $=\sqrt{N^{2} + f^{2}}$
But $N=mg,f=\mu mg$
Force = $mg\sqrt{1 + \mu ^{2}}$
